The Role of VFFS Machines in Sustainable Packaging

Reducing Packaging Waste

VFFS machines minimize packaging waste through precise material usage. Unlike pre-made bags, which often have excess material, VFFS machines form bags on-demand to fit the product size. This reduces waste by up to 30% for granular products and 20% for liquids. Advanced models also include film edge trimmers that repurpose excess material into usable strips.

Energy Efficiency in VFFS Operations

Modern VFFS machines are designed for energy efficiency. Key features include: 1) Servo motors that use 40% less energy than traditional motors, 2) LED heating elements for sealing (reduces power consumption by 50%), and 3) Standby modes that cut energy use during idle periods. Some machines even use regenerative braking to capture energy from moving parts.

Sustainable Packaging Materials for VFFS Machines

Compostable and Biodegradable Films

Compostable films (like PLA and PHA) are becoming popular for VFFS packaging. These materials break down in industrial composting facilities within 180 days. VFFS machines for compostable films require modified sealing systems (lower temperatures to prevent melting) and precise tension control. Some manufacturers offer retrofitting kits for existing machines.

Recycled and Recyclable Films

Recycled films (PCR – Post-Consumer Recycled) are another sustainable option. VFFS machines can handle PCR films with thicknesses of 50-150 microns. To ensure seal integrity, use films with a sealant layer made from recycled materials. Recyclable films (like PP and PE) are easier to process and can be recycled multiple times.

Optimizing VFFS Machines for Sustainable Production

Lightweighting Packaging

Lightweighting reduces the amount of material used per package. VFFS machines enable lightweighting by: 1) Using thinner films (down to 20 microns for some products), 2) Eliminating unnecessary layers (e.g., removing foil from snack packaging), and 3) Using micro-perforations for breathability instead of thicker films. Lightweighting can reduce packaging costs by 15-25%.

Reducing Carbon Footprint

VFFS machines help reduce carbon footprint through: 1) Local sourcing of packaging materials (cuts transportation emissions), 2) Energy-efficient operation (as mentioned earlier), and 3) Waste reduction (less material sent to landfills). Some companies use carbon accounting tools to track the environmental impact of their VFFS operations.

Case Studies: Sustainable VFFS Packaging Success

Snack Company Achieves Zero Waste to Landfill

A snack manufacturer switched to compostable films and optimized their VFFS machine for lightweighting. The changes reduced packaging waste by 40% and eliminated 100 tons of plastic from landfills annually. The company also saved $120,000 per year in packaging costs.

Beverage Brand Reduces Carbon Footprint by 30%

A beverage brand replaced their pre-made bottles with VFFS pouches made from recycled plastic. The VFFS machine reduced packaging material usage by 50% and cut transportation emissions by 30% (lighter pouches mean more per shipment). The brand’s sustainability efforts increased customer loyalty by 20%.

Circular Economy Integration

The circular economy focuses on reusing materials. Future VFFS machines will include: 1) On-site recycling systems for packaging waste, 2) Compostable film compatibility as a standard feature, and 3) Digital tracking of packaging materials (using blockchain) to ensure recyclability.

AI-Powered Sustainability Optimization

AI will play a key role in sustainable VFFS operations. AI algorithms will: 1) Optimize film usage in real-time (reducing waste), 2) Predict maintenance needs (minimizing energy waste from broken machines), and 3) Recommend the most sustainable packaging materials for each product.

Choosing a Sustainable VFFS Machine Supplier

Key Supplier Qualifications

When selecting a sustainable VFFS machine supplier, look for: 1) ISO 14001 certification (environmental management), 2) Experience with compostable/recycled films, and 3) A commitment to circular economy principles. Reputable suppliers offer life-cycle assessments of their machines.

Cost-Benefit Analysis of Sustainable VFFS Machines

While sustainable VFFS machines may have a higher initial cost, they offer long-term savings: 1) Lower packaging material costs (lightweighting), 2) Reduced energy bills (energy efficiency), and 3) Tax incentives for sustainable practices. Most machines pay for themselves within 2-3 years.
